WebApr 11, 2024 · Port wine is a sweet, red wine that is typically served as a dessert wine. It is made from red grapes that are grown in the Douro Valley of Portugal. The grapes are fermented with the skins on, which gives the wine its characteristic red color. Port wine is typically fortified with brandy, which adds to its sweetness. WebMay 31, 2024 · Port is a sweet red wine that originates from the Douro region of northern Portugal, while sherry is made with white grapes and comes from what is known as “the Sherry Triangle,” an area in the province of Cádiz in Spain. Both are fortified, which means brandy or a neutral distilled spirit is added. WebThe most expensive wines from Vintage Port. Vintage Port is the most expensive and prestigious member of the Port family. It is "declared" in only the best years, when both the quality and quantity of the available fruit align. WebJan 31, 2024 · Ruby: the least expensive Port produced in the greatest volumes. After fermentation it is stored in tank to prevent oxidative aging to ensure a fruity, brightly colored product. Tawny Port is relatively expensive, but for those who pride themselves as true wine lovers, there is no price for a good bottle of authentic, aged … WebThe price of Tawny Port varies according to the age, the 40-year olds being the most expensive ones. Usually, Tawny Ports fall in these price ranges: 10 year old = $18-$32. 20 year old = $28-$55. 30 year old = $60-$90. 40 year …

WebPort Wine Price On average you can expect to pay anywhere between $30 and $50 for a decent bottle of Port. Some quality Ports could set you back in excess of $200. While this might be slightly higher than the average bottle of wine, it’s important to remember that you can keep Port for several days.

WebThere are two basic types of port, Ruby and Tawny, they have a lot in common: Both are fortified and sweet, both come from the Douro River valley in Portugal, both are made by the same producers from the same group of approved grape varieties, and both run the gamut of style, quality and price from every day to extraordinary.
